Discovering Bali on a Quad Bike

Ubud Quad Bike: Best Bali ATV Ride Adventure - Discovering Bali on a Quad Bike

This 2-hour ATV tour is designed to give you a taste of the best Bali has to offer, all from the seat of a powerful automatic 250 cc quad bike. The experience is centered around exploring Bali’s lush rice terraces, dense jungle, flowing rivers, and tunnels—each offering a new photo opportunity and a different sensory experience. The tour is based around Ubud, Bali’s cultural heart, but the views you’ll encounter make it feel like stepping into a hidden Bali paradise.

Safety and Guidance

One of the standout aspects of this tour is the full safety briefing provided by professional guides. Reviewers consistently praise the safety standards, with guides like Made and Wayan leading the way, ensuring every rider understands the bike controls and safety gear. Helmets, life jackets, and boots are included, giving you peace of mind while tackling the terrain.

The guides are also skilled at tailoring the pace to the group’s comfort level. For example, some reviews note that the ride can vary from gentle paths to more technical slopes. If you crave a challenge, instructors can guide you through tougher sections like steep inclines and muddy patches, but they will keep safety front and center.

The Terrain and Experience

The terrain varies from gentle rice field paths to more technical jungle tracks. Expect to navigate tight turns, muddy patches, and slopes that test your riding skills—yet everything is guided and controlled, making it suitable for beginners and more experienced riders alike.

According to reviews, the ride often includes passing through tunnels and crossing rivers, which add a sense of adventure. Some riders even mention throwing up plenty of mud, which indicates how engaging and playful the ride can be, especially after rain.

Authentic Lunch and Facilities

After the ride, you’ll be treated to a buffet Indonesian lunch—simple, flavorful, and filling—featuring rice, chicken, noodles, and salads. Reviewers appreciated the variety and the chance to refuel with local flavors in a relaxed setting.

Facilities include lockers, showers, changing rooms, and towels, allowing you to freshen up after the ride. The inclusion of insurance coverage and government taxes means you’re not just paying for the fun but also for peace of mind.

Price and Value

At $35 per person, this tour offers good value, especially considering the included transport, lunch, safety gear, and professional guidance. The fact that most riders book at least 25 days in advance suggests high demand and confidence in the experience.

Practical Details and Tips

Ubud Quad Bike: Best Bali ATV Ride Adventure - Practical Details and Tips

  • Age Restrictions: Children as young as 5 can participate, but those aged 12 and above can ride solo; younger kids must ride tandem with an adult.
  • Clothing: Wear comfortable, casual clothes—you might get muddy. Bring sunscreen, camera, and a change of clothes.
  • Weather: The tour runs rain or shine—rain can make the terrain more fun and muddy but be prepared for potentially slippery patches.
  • Booking: Most travelers book about 25 days in advance, so plan ahead to secure your spot.
  • Group Size: This is a private tour, so you’ll be riding with your own group, which enhances the experience.

Is hotel pickup included?
Yes, if you select the package that includes transfers, the tour offers hotel pickup and drop-off, making logistics hassle-free.

What is the minimum age to participate?
Children as young as 5 years old can join, but for solo rides, the minimum age is 12. Kids 5-11 must ride tandem with an adult.

Do I need previous experience to ride?
No prior experience is necessary. Guides provide a safety briefing and instruction, and the ride is suitable for beginners.

Is the tour suitable in rainy weather?
Yes, the activity runs rain or shine. Rain may make the terrain more muddy and exciting, but be prepared for a potentially slippery ride.

What should I bring?
Bring sunscreen, a camera, change of clothes, and anything else you want to keep handy during the ride.

How long is the ride?
The ride lasts approximately 2 hours, including guided stops and exploring different terrains.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, cancellations are free if made at least 24 hours in advance, and you’ll receive a full refund.
